2021 Chamber Music Composition Competition

The Bantam Winds strive to promote the composition and performance of new chamber music, specifically for the unique combination of oboe, clarinet, and horn. This year’s competition will encourage collegiate students to begin fulfilling this mission within the region of Northeast Arkansas. There will be two separate categories of entries: original compositions and arrangements. Composers may only submit once for either category but are allowed one entry in each if interested. One winner from each category will be featured in a masterclass with composer Celka Ojakangas and will also have their piece video recorded by the Bantam Winds and released on social media and Youtube.

ELIGIBILITY:
The inaugural 2021 competition is open to any student currently enrolled in an undergraduate or graduate program at Arkansas State University - Jonesboro.  

COMPETITION GUIDELINES:
Both categories of entry will adhere to the same parameters. Pieces may not exceed 5 minutes of duration and may be written for any combination of the following Bantam Winds instrumentation of:  e-flat/b-flat/bass clarinet, oboe/english horn, horn. Note that entries may only feature one member of each cohort (eg. only bass clarinet or b-flat clarinet) and that there is no doubling allowed within the individual parts. Composers are asked to be mindful of extreme registers and of providing ample rests for the performers. Extended techniques and mutes are allowed so long as they do not endanger the instrument. Please consult the performers with any questions regarding any desired specific techniques or effects.

 JUDGING:
The competition will be judged by the members of the Bantam Winds as well as Dr. Derek Jenkins. Criteria will consist of technical skill, performability, artistic promise, quality of engraving, and originality. Decisions will be announced no later than one week after the submission deadline on May 1st. All entries will receive comments. One winner will be selected in each category. They will be allowed to sit in for one rehearsal of their piece with the Bantam Winds before being featured in a virtual live-streamed masterclass with composer Celka Ojakangas. In lieu of live performance, the Bantam Winds will produce and release a video recording of the piece on social media.
